Hamilton can surpass Schumacher, Whitmarsh says
Jan 29 2009, 03:44 PM
McLaren-Mercedes driver Lewis Hamilton has the potential to leave behind a better record than track legend Michael Schumacher when he retires, according to New McLaren team chief Martin Whitmarsh.

The current Formula One world champion can match and even beat Schumacher's record of seven wins, said the new executive in an interview with the Guardian newspaper.

"He won't talk about it because he's too modest, and what Michael did is extraordinary. But with great champions you don't want to match it, you want to beat it," said Whitmarsh.

"The key thing about Lewis is that he's still very young and he hasn't reached the peak of his powers as a racing driver."

Last year supercar lovers, sports car hire fans and motorsports enthusiasts were among droves that were glued to television screens worldwide as the then 23-year-old scooped the title.

Hamilton won the race in the very last seconds of the duel in Brazil by snatching the title from Ferrari's Felipe Massa's grasp by a single point.
